Gorgeous, hand-thrown 1950s vase by master potter, Denis Vibert. 6.25" tall, 5" diameter. Crafted at Pine Treen Kiln in Sullivan, Maine - the studio he shared with his wife, Ruth, who ran the gallery. The body is made of terracotta with a matte green-blue mottled/speckled glaze. Modern, simplistic shape. Vibert’s pieces are highly-collectible and hard to come by. Signed by the artist “Vibert Maine” on the base.
